How to Choose the Best Copy Trading Platform
How to Choose the Best Copy Trading Platform
Finding the right copy trading platform in 2025 is all about aligning your goals, risk appetite, and user experience preferences. Here are the key factors to consider:
1. Regulation and Trustworthiness
Make sure the platform is regulated in your region or works with regulated brokerages. This helps protect your funds and ensures the platform adheres to compliance standards.
2. Asset Variety
Some platforms focus on crypto, while others offer access to equities, forex, or ETFs. Choose one that supports the markets you're interested in.
3. Performance Transparency
Look for platforms that show verified, real-time performance metrics for traders. The ability to filter by trader type, risk, and performance history is a big plus.
4. Fee Structure
Understand how the platform charges you, whether it’s a flat subscription, a share of profits, or spreads on trades. Opt for models that align with your budget and risk level.
5. User Experience
Mobile vs. desktop? Basic vs. advanced features? Social interaction vs. pure automation? Match the platform’s UX to your investing style to make it a seamless experience.
6. Risk Management Tools
Features like stop loss, capital allocation controls, and trader filtering help you avoid copying risky or volatile strategies.
